Abstract :
It is recognized that developing a formalism for content-based multimedia systems is essential for developing sufficiently reliable and mission critical applications. The paper tries to formalize the whole paradigm of content-based multimedia retrieval. The formalism will provide a generic criterion for system evaluation, and methods to customize the system engine to applications. It is believed that this formalism adds semantics to multimedia systems and leads the database technology from tool level into application level
